Meldreth Train Station, managed by Great Northern, offers a variety of facilities to ensure a hassle-free journey. The ticket office is open Monday through Saturday until early afternoon, though there are ticket machines available around the clock for your convenience. Plus, if you've purchased your ticket online, you can easily collect it at the station.
While there aren’t any waiting rooms, Meldreth does provide seating areas for commuters. CCTV cameras are strategically placed to maintain security throughout the station, including the 45-space car park operated by APCOA Parking UK. Parking here is free, adding additional convenience compared to many larger UK stations.
The station may have limitations when it comes to full accessibility. While there is step-free access to Platform 2, accessing Platform 1 to London requires navigating steps. Therefore, travelers needing assistance can find additional support through staff assistance and a mobile assistance team available during station hours. Unfortunately, there are no accessible toilets available.
For cyclists, there are 20 bicycle storage spaces available by the station entrance to Platform 2. However, be aware that there is no cycle hire facility or shelters for bicycles. Salisbury Train Station boasts a range of amenities dedicated to enhancing your travel experience. The ticket office operates from early morning at 5:30 AM until 8:00 PM on weekdays, with slightly adjusted hours on weekends. This ensures ample time to purchase or collect tickets. The station is well-equipped with ticket machines that cater to accessible needs and allow for easy ticket collection from online purchases. For those using smartcards, the station provides issuance and validation services right on site.
Travelers with accessibility needs will be pleased to find step-free access to all platforms, complemented by ramps and staff assistance to ensure seamless mobility throughout the station. Accessible toilets, heated waiting rooms, and seating areas are available to provide added comfort. Although there is no luggage storage, other services include public Wi-Fi and ATM machines, making the station a convenient location for travelers.
The station is committed to ensuring accessibility for all passengers. This includes the presence of accessible ticket machines and step-free access to platforms. A powered wheelchair operated by station staff is also available for enhanced assistance. While there are a few dedicated accessible parking spaces, it is advisable to contact South Western Railway's Customer Service Centre for any specific accessibility concerns, ensuring your journey is as smooth as possible.
